Output 16ab3f3ebf6e261cf89f609c91d5c29d9c75a353948baf76b2e57eae6f2ae699:0

value
102100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b59061d615ac4a76c577a42428a255d2308658b OP_EQUALVERIFY OP_CHECKSIG
address
1Dhoa9qrSJDqukJnKaEQUUCQ5RehA9eg2T
transaction
16ab3f3ebf6e261cf89f609c91d5c29d9c75a353948baf76b2e57eae6f2ae699
spent
true